Michael Alan "OBES" Oberembt Obituary

Michael Alan Oberembt, known affectionately to many as “Obes,” passed away due to complications from influenza on Tuesday, January 6, 2026. A Visitation will be held on Friday, January 30, from 2:00–4:00 p.m. at the DoubleTree (1500 Park Place Blvd). A Memorial service will follow at 4:00 p.m., with dinner afterward.


In keeping with Michael’s wishes, the evening will continue with live music, dancing, and the sharing of stories from 7:00 p.m. to midnight.


Michael was born on March 3, 1980, in Des Moines, Iowa, to Marla Andrews and Russell Oberembt. He graduated from Park Center High School in Brooklyn Park, Minnesota in 1998. Michael was a self-taught IT technician and beloved coworker of many years. He was widely known as a fixture of the Minneapolis music scene he adored, and will be remembered for his kindness, humor, and loyalty.


Michael’s zest for life was boundless. His greatest joys included football, live music, poker, good food, and any chance to be near the water. Michael treasured time spent visiting friends at the lake, adventures in the Las Vegas desert, soaking up the Arizona sun, and watching sunsets on Hawaiian beaches. More than anything, he valued connection—showing up for friends, sharing laughter, and creating lasting memories.


Michael is survived by his brother, Lance; his grandmother, Ann; his uncles Myles Andrews and Rick (Cindy) Oberembt; his aunt Lee Lenahan; and many cousins and dear friends. He was preceded in death by his mother, Marla, and his father, Russell. His spirit lives on in the music, laughter, and friendships he cherished.


In lieu of flowers, memorials will be accepted by the family for MS Society of Minnesota.
